In Reply to: RE: cPlay - the open source high-end audio player using ASIO posted by cics on May 05, 2008 at 12:31:58
I corrected the list of my tweak in my message here http://www.audioasylum.com/forums/pcaudio/messages/9/96990.html
I returned following files:
c_1252.nls
clbcatq.dll
comres.dll
crypt32.dll
imagehlp.dll
JulaWDM.sys
R000000000007.clb (into folder Registration)
wintrust.dll
because they are used by cMP and cPlay (you can see it in the program ProcessExplorer and Everest launched on "classic" optimized cMP2).
